Alaun Park: A Historical Green Space
Alaun Park, known by locals as Alaunplatz, is a treasured public area in Dresden that has roots dating back to the 18th century.
This park was established to serve the community and provides a significant social space for the residents of the Neustadt district. It features tree-lined paths, open grassy areas, and is frequented by both locals and visitors. The park's design reflects historical landscaping trends, while modern amenities cater to various recreational activities.
